How Do RNGs Work?
At its core, an RNG is a sophisticated algorithm designed to generate a sequence of numbers. These numbers are entirely random, ensuring that the outcomes of online casino games are not predictable or influenced by external factors. The algorithm takes a seed value as input and uses complex mathematical calculations to produce a series of random numbers.

The Constantly Changing Numbers
RNGs operate at remarkable speeds, generating a continuous stream of numbers even when games are not being played. This unceasing randomness guarantees that the outcomes are never influenced by previous results.
RNG Testing and Certification
To ensure compliance with industry standards, independent testing agencies rigorously evaluate RNGs. Only after meticulous testing and certification can an online casino confidently declare its games fair and its RNG trustworthy.

- The Role of RNGs in Cryptography and Security
RNGs are instrumental in creating secure encryption keys that protect sensitive data from unauthorized access. True randomness is vital in cryptography, as patterns or predictability could lead to breaches. As cybersecurity becomes increasingly crucial, the reliability of RNGs is paramount.
- Scientific Simulations and Modeling
In scientific research, RNGs are employed to simulate complex phenomena and systems. From climate modeling to particle physics simulations, RNGs introduce an element of unpredictability, allowing researchers to explore a range of possible outcomes and scenarios.

Implementing RNGs
- Choose a Suitable RNG: Depending on your application, select an appropriate RNG algorithm, be it pseudorandom or cryptographically secure.
- Seed Initialization: Provide an initial seed value to kickstart the sequence. This seed should be unpredictable to enhance randomness.
- Number Generation: Execute the chosen algorithm to generate a sequence of numbers.
- Periodicity Check: Monitor the generated sequence for any patterns or repetitions.
- Entropy Source: Incorporate entropy sources like system events or hardware noise to increase randomness.
- Testing and Validation: Employ statistical tests to assess the quality of generated sequences.
- Seeding Regeneration: Periodically reseed to prevent predictability in long sequences.
